FOUR-LAYERED MATERIAL FOR A FLEXIBLE FLUID RESERVOIR
20230131001 · 2023-04-27 ·

Disclosed are flexible fluid reservoirs including a front sheet and a back sheet, each comprising a four-layer insulated wall. The four-layer insulated wall includes an interior layer and an exterior layer, and a metallic film layer and an insulation layer disposed between the interior layer and the exterior layer where the metallic film layer is oriented toward the exterior layer and the insulation layer is oriented toward the interior layer. One or more of the interior or exterior layers can be a metallocene modified polyethylene film. The metallic film layer can be aluminum coated polyethylene terephthalate resin. The insulation layer can be a foam layer comprising closed cell polyethylene resin. The four-layer insulated wall can resist or limit temperature changes of a fluid disposed within the reservoir for a period of time. The insulated fluid reservoirs can include closure mechanisms for sealing an upper opening of the reservoir.

ALL-POLYETHYLENE LAMINATE FILM STRUCTURES HAVING BARRIER ADHESIVE LAYER
20220324214 · 2022-10-13 ·

Recyclable, all-polyethylene laminate film structures suitable for use in a flexible packaging are disclosed. The structures comprise a film layer consisting essentially of an ethylene-based polymer and a barrier adhesive layer disposed on a surface of the film layer, wherein the structure has an oxygen transmission rate not greater than 100 O.sub.2/m.sup.2/day, measured according to ASTM Method D3985. Recyclable, all-polyethylene laminate film structures suitable for use in a flexible packaging are disclosed comprising (A) a sealant film layer consisting essentially of an ethylene-based polymer, (B) an intermediate film layer consisting essentially of an ethylene-based polymer, (C) a structural film layer consisting essentially of an ethylene-based polymer, and (D) a barrier adhesive layer, wherein the recyclable, all-polyethylene laminate film structure has an oxygen transmission rate not greater than 100 O.sub.2/m.sup.2/day, measured according to ASTM Method D3985. Articles comprising the disclosed laminate film structures, such as flexible packaging and stand-up pouches, are also disclosed.

Single-Use Bioprocessing Bag for Growing Cell Media, and Multilayer Film
20230060563 · 2023-03-02 ·

A multilayer bioreactor bag (20) made from a multilayer film (10), the bag having: inner and outer exterior surface layers (11, 16) on opposing faces of the multilayer film (10) consisting essentially of a low density polyethylene having a density in a range of 0.91 to 0.94 g/cc to provide a non-tacky exterior surface layers; interior layers disposed between the exterior surface layers comprising a gas barrier layer (14) and a structural layer (12) comprising an ethylene alpha-olefin elastomer having a density in a range of 0.87-0.91 to provide a flexible support to the multilayer film.
